How Reliable is the Peugeot 206?

Based on 9,831,622 MOT tests across 644,158 vehicles.

67.7%
Pass Rate
5,510
Miles/Year
28
Year Lifespan
644,158
On UK Roads

Top MOT Failure Points

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m 446,851
Registration plate lamp not working 342,991
position lamp(s) not working 334,912
Exhaust has a major leak of exhaust gases 262,537
Windscreen wiper does not clear the windscreen effectively 219,688

HNZ 2943 is a 1998 Peugeot 206 in Black with a 1,124c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 9 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 55.6%.

Across all 1998 Peugeot 206 models, the average MOT pass rate is 61.0% with a typical mileage of 77,978 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Peugeot 206 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 446,851 recorded failures. If you're considering buying HNZ 2943,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Peugeot 206 typically stays on UK roads for around 28 years. At 28 years old, this Peugeot 206 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
